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17808685 3898150 487694806 11293
2476822056 281918730 255920016
2476822056 281918730 255920016
6791932 54 0276 4075
All about undefined
Interested in learning more?
2476822056 281918730 255920016
6791932 54 0276 4075
See more
915856 8294
041019645 0442087 87722
See more
81457693 328255 677987
828831 060460174 70479
See more